
SB Energy, an AI power infrastructure company backed by SoftBank, OpenAI, and Nvidia, has filed for an IPO with the SEC despite having zero operational data centers and no revenue to date. The company posted a $3.2 billion net loss in the first half of 2026 from heavy data center investment, and remains heavily dependent on OpenAI as both a key tenant and investor. SB Energy is targeting $5-7 billion in proceeds, with shares set to list on Nasdaq under ticker SBE.
